Despite its proven effectiveness and safety profile, the XEN Gel Stent (Allergan Inc., CA, USA) has a small lumen and is therefore likely to become occluded by fibrin, a blood clot, or even the iris. However, few studies have investigated XEN-iris occlusion and how to manage this condition.
